				twist 'os
			 
 take a twist tie   and then with a sharp knife remove the plastic or paper covering  it  and you have a thin gauge wire that can help clean out windshield washer nozzles and spray paint nozzles too 
not to mention carburater fuel jets on small engines without wrecking them with something larger.     |
